What Are We Up To?

- We had our Board Meeting on Monday, June 6th. Items discussed included adoption of our Budget for the 2022/2023 fiscal year, the PG&E settlement money and scheduling a special meeting to move forward, the Fair, the Fair Parade, flower baskets and the Plumas County Chamber Coalition. Our next meeting is scheduled for Wednesday, July 13th at 7:00 a.m. via Zoom. If you would like to attend please send us an email at info@quincychamber.com.

- On June 8th and 9th we assisted with the Community Tour, the Community Opening Meeting and the Workshop as part of the Recreation Economy for Rural Communities (RERC) grant program that Sierra Buttes Trail Stewardship obtained. Read below for more details and see pictures.

- On June 13th Cheryl applied for two grants through the Feather River Tourism Association; one for Sparkle and one for Groundhog Fever Festival. The intent of these grants will be to extend advertising for the two events in an effort to increase overnight stays in our area.
